Company Valuation: Tubacex, S.A.

Data adjusted to current consolidation scope
Fiscal Period: December 2021 2022 2023 2024 2025 2026 2027 2028
Market Cap 1 185.1 241.6 422.7 395.8 409.6 393.9 - -
Change - 30.54% 74.99% -6.36% 3.48% -3.83% - -
Enterprise Value (EV) 1 521.3 528.7 703.4 650.8 754.4 742.6 693.1 672.8
Change - 1.42% 33.05% -7.48% 15.91% -1.56% -6.67% -2.93%
P/E Ratio -5.78x 12.5x 12.1x 18.1x -13.3x 42.3x 16.1x 9.4x
PBR 0.94x 1.09x 1.76x 1.09x 1.4x 1.41x 1.27x 1.32x
PEG - -0x 0.1x -0.5x 0x -0x 0x 0.1x
Capitalization / Revenue 0.54x 0.34x 0.5x 0.52x 0.57x 0.57x 0.46x 0.43x
EV / Revenue 1.52x 0.74x 0.83x 0.85x 1.05x 1.07x 0.8x 0.74x
EV / EBITDA 38.9x 5.72x 5.62x 6.08x 7.13x 6.67x 5.16x 4.01x
EV / EBIT -16.8x 11.9x 8.71x 10.2x 12.9x 18.1x 9.44x 6.52x
EV / FCF -10.3x 8.75x 20.2x -6.29x -9.46x 17.3x 16.1x 11.2x
FCF Yield -9.72% 11.4% 4.94% -15.9% -10.6% 5.79% 6.2% 8.92%
Dividend per Share 2 - - - - - 0.03 0.0912 0.0682
Rate of return - - - - - 0.93% 2.84% 2.13%
EPS 2 -0.26 0.16 0.29 0.18 -0.25 0.0759 0.1999 0.3417
Distribution rate - - - - - 39.5% 45.6% 20%
Net sales 1 341.9 714.7 852.4 767.5 719.3 696.9 864.4 908.9
EBITDA 1 13.41 92.35 125.2 107 105.8 111.3 134.2 167.6
EBIT 1 -31.12 44.45 80.74 63.52 58.3 40.94 73.45 103.1
Net income 1 -32.21 20.23 36.33 22.85 -31.28 10.05 25.51 43.62
Net Debt 1 336.2 287.1 280.7 255 344.8 348.7 299.2 278.9
Reference price 2 1.502 1.998 3.500 3.255 3.335 3.210 3.210 3.210
Nbr of stocks (in thousands) 1,23,202 1,20,906 1,20,777 1,21,607 1,22,815 1,22,706 - -
Announcement Date 24/02/22 24/02/23 29/02/24 27/02/25 26/02/26 - - -
1EUR in Million2EUR
Estimates

P/E Ratio, Detailed evolution

P/E (Y) EV / Sales (Y) EV / EBITDA (Y) Dividend Yield (Y) Capi.($)
24.15x1.01x6.33x1.49% 46Cr
16x1.58x9.14x0.9% 5.7TCr
13.87x0.85x6.72x0.97% 4.9TCr
17.1x1.85x10.99x0.79% 3.87TCr
13.34x1.24x7.29x2.08% 2.61TCr
50.21x8.38x30.92x0.15% 2.6TCr
14.14x0.59x5.52x2.73% 1.8TCr
-66.11x0.75x7.55x4.43% 1.77TCr
13.53x4.07x10.55x0.06% 1.01TCr
13.06x0.87x6.49x2.89% 1.01TCr
Average 10.93x 2.12x 10.15x 1.65% 2.53TCr
Weighted average by Cap. 12.93x 2.09x 10.58x 1.36%

Y-o-Y evolution of P/E

Historical PBR trend

Evolution Enterprise Value / Sales

Change in Enterprise Value/EBITDA

Year-on-year evolution of the Yield

  1. Stock Market
  2. Stocks
  3. TUB Stock
  4. Valuation Tubacex, S.A.
40% Discount: Identify Tomorrow's Best Investments With The Best Subscriber-Only Tools!
d
:
:
SEIZE THE OFFER!